Responsibility

Expectations

Preparation of Project schedule 

Prepare project schedule with clearly defined critical path and milestone and highlight clearance required from customer

Resource and subcon deployment

Ensure competent resources are deployed at site to handle project effectively. Efficient and competent subcon with adequate manpower is deployed to meet the project timeline

Monitoring site Progress - Planned Vs Actual

Review the design and construction progress with design and project  team weekly and may be daily depending on volume and complexity of the project.  Site walk with Project engineer to monitor the site progress in line with schedule

Quality check and audits

During site walk check for quality of installation. Ensure audits done periodically and findings are addressed on immediate basis. Ensure project engineer do not repeat the findings of audit.

Coordination with cross functional team like design , SCM,L&D, Quality & finance

Coordinate with internal stake holders to ensure project deliveries are met. Highlight to next level in organization if any support required to ensure project timelines are not hampered.

Maintain Project Cash Flow – AR Collections

Timely invoicing / AR collection/ Account statement is maintained for each project.

Project completion and hand over

Pre-commissioning check to be done before T&C. Ask for any technical or resource support to ROM/AOM in advance. Start preparing O&M, As built, manual during Pre-commissioning stage only.
